Can Radeon RX 7800 XT run Physics World: Evolution?
PlayableThe Radeon RX 7800 XT can run Physics World: Evolution at 1080p, but may not reach 60 FPS at High settings (estimated 50 FPS). Lowering to Medium should achieve around 63 FPS.
Physics World: Evolution – Radeon RX 7800 XT FPS Data
| Quality | 1080p | 1440p | 4K |
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| 79 fps | 59 fps | 32 fps |
| Medium | 63 fps | 47 fps | 25 fps |
| High | 50 fps | 38 fps | 20 fps |
| Ultra | 41 fps | 31 fps | 16 fps |
Estimated FPS · actual performance may vary based on drivers and settings

To enjoy Physics World: Evolution smoothly, a mid-range GPU like the RTX 4060 or RX 7600 is recommended. This level of graphics processing power ensures that players can experience the game's physics simulation without significant lag or frame drops. The game is designed to be accessible, making it suitable for a wide range of systems, but having the right GPU will enhance the overall experience, especially when pushing graphical settings higher.
For those on lower-end setups, targeting 1080p resolution with medium settings should provide a playable experience, while players with more capable hardware can aim for 1440p at high settings for a visually stunning performance. With a minimum requirement of 8 GB of RAM, most modern systems should handle the game well.
